Former Roma executive, Walter Sabatini, praised the club’s appointment of Tiago Pinto, the Giallorossi’s new General Director.

The capital club appointed the 36 year-old in late November to oversee all football-related matters after he spent the previous eight years with Portuguese giants Benfica.

“Pinto will be working in a very complicated environment, but he’s a young and talented executive,” said the 65 year-old, who is currently the Global Sporting Director at Bologna, to Sky Sport.

”He has important experience from his time at Benfica and has all of the credentials to do well.”

Sabatini spent five seasons at Roma and was widely praised for the abundance of talented players that he was able to acquire during his time in the Italian capital.

Despite his success, he departed the club in 2016 after falling out with former President James Pallotta.
